Output 2e878433a0220e25a7601922aba63eb3ff39ac1f6405edd4c67d7aa6a6717af2:0

value
21578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f918b3a4ff4dd20a6a909fe34ee1dbfa2ab084ad OP_EQUAL
address
3QQ7mchMwDY7GWY4gC8w1Rgasramds23D9
transaction
2e878433a0220e25a7601922aba63eb3ff39ac1f6405edd4c67d7aa6a6717af2
spent
true